// Claude (Anthropic) Tool Search Capability
//
// When added to an agent, enables Anthropic's hosted tool_search (deferred tool
// loading) for Claude models with tool_search=true in their profile. Each tool's
// full parameter schema is loaded on-demand by the model via a server-side
// `tool_search_tool_*_20251119` tool instead of being sent upfront.
//
// Like `openai_tool_search`, this capability provides no tools itself — it sets a
// provider-agnostic `ToolSearchConfig`. The Anthropic driver consumes that config
// and renders the hosted format (`defer_loading: true` per tool plus a
// `tool_search_tool_bm25_20251119` entry). See `crates/anthropic/src/driver.rs`.
//
// If the model does not support tool_search (tool_search=false in the Anthropic
// profile), this capability is silently ignored — no error, no crash. Use
// `auto_tool_search` for a model-adaptive default that picks this on native
// Claude models and the generic client-side mechanism elsewhere.
use super::{Capability, CapabilityLocalization, CapabilityStatus, SystemPromptContext};
use crate::driver_registry::ToolSearchConfig;
use async_trait::async_trait;
pub use super::openai_tool_search::DEFAULT_TOOL_SEARCH_THRESHOLD;
/// Capability ID for Claude (Anthropic) tool search.
pub const CLAUDE_TOOL_SEARCH_CAPABILITY_ID: &str = "claude_tool_search";
/// Claude Tool Search capability.
///
/// Adding this capability to an agent/harness enables deferred tool loading for
/// Claude models that support it. The `threshold` controls the minimum number of
/// tools before tool_search activates (default: [`DEFAULT_TOOL_SEARCH_THRESHOLD`]).
pub struct ClaudeToolSearchCapability {
threshold: usize,
}
impl ClaudeToolSearchCapability {
pub fn new() -> Self {
Self {
threshold: DEFAULT_TOOL_SEARCH_THRESHOLD,
}
}
pub fn with_threshold(threshold: usize) -> Self {
Self { threshold }
}
/// Returns the `ToolSearchConfig` for this capability.
///
/// The config is provider-agnostic — the same shape `openai_tool_search`
/// produces. The Anthropic driver renders it into the hosted Messages-API
/// format; the OpenAI Responses driver renders it into the Responses format.
/// Whichever driver handles the request decides the wire shape, so this
/// carries no provider tag.
pub fn tool_search_config(&self) -> ToolSearchConfig {
ToolSearchConfig {
enabled: true,
threshold: self.threshold,
}
}
}
/// Whether `model` natively supports Anthropic's hosted tool_search.
///
/// This is the single source of truth for the native-Claude decision, consulted
/// by `auto_tool_search`'s runtime dispatch (at capability-collection time) and
/// by `RuntimeAgentBuilder::build` (when reconciling a hosted config with the
/// model). Native Claude tool_search is an Anthropic Messages-API feature, so the
/// lookup is against the Anthropic provider profile regardless of how the model
/// is otherwise routed (a Claude model reached via OpenRouter/Bedrock has the
/// flag masked off in `get_model_profile` and falls back to client-side search).
pub fn model_supports_native_tool_search(model: &str) -> bool {
crate::model_profiles::get_model_profile(&crate::provider::DriverId::Anthropic, model)
.is_some_and(|profile| profile.tool_search)
}
impl Default for ClaudeToolSearchCapability {
fn default() -> Self {
Self::new()
}
}
#[async_trait]
impl Capability for ClaudeToolSearchCapability {
fn id(&self) -> &str {
CLAUDE_TOOL_SEARCH_CAPABILITY_ID
}
fn name(&self) -> &str {
"Claude Tool Search"
}
fn description(&self) -> &str {
"Enables deferred tool loading for Claude models that support it \
(Sonnet 4, Opus 4, Haiku 4.5, and Fable 5 and newer). Reduces token \
usage by loading tool schemas on-demand instead of upfront."
}
fn localizations(&self) -> Vec<CapabilityLocalization> {
vec![CapabilityLocalization::text(
"uk",
"Пошук інструментів Claude",
"Вмикає відкладене завантаження інструментів для моделей Claude, які його підтримують (Sonnet 4, Opus 4, Haiku 4.5 та Fable 5 і новіші). Зменшує використання токенів, завантажуючи схеми інструментів на вимогу, а не заздалегідь.",
)]
}
fn status(&self) -> CapabilityStatus {
CapabilityStatus::Available
}
fn category(&self) -> Option<&str> {
Some("Optimization")
}
async fn system_prompt_contribution(&self, _ctx: &SystemPromptContext) -> Option<String> {
None // No system prompt needed — deferral is handled server-side.
}
}
